What are actually synchronized and how:
On Opera 10.* browser, all your Opera Mini 5 bookmarks should be displayed in 'Opera Mini' folder. However, for some reason developers decided not to show desktop bookmarks in the same way under Opera Mini 5 bookmarks. To use and edit your desktop bookmarks on Opera Mini 5, add either speed dial or bookmark for Opera Link like this:
http://my.opera.com/YOUR_ACCOUNT_NAME_HERE/account/link/bookmarks/
In other words, you can access Opera Link and desktop bookmarks via MyOpera menu up there on this page
Just add shortcut for it into your Opera Mini speed dials or into bookmarks.
